Situated in the first hills of Conegliano, preciselly in San Pietro di Feletto, de Bernard uses only the finest estate-grown fruit to craft our prestigous Prosecco DOCG and sparkling wines. Created using the innovative method of Charmat-Martinotti production, their meticulously crafted wines combine passion artistry and science – all for offering you a unique product capable of enriching your special moments.

Vinification

Harvest between the end of September and the beginning of October. Soft pressing of grapes, then the juice ferments at a controlled temperature in stainless steel tanks. Second fermentation takes place in large closed cisterns at 12-14° C, with a 2 months-storage on yeast.

Tasting notes

Light straw yellow in colour with greenish highlights. The texture is fine, compact and persistent. It has a well-typed and delicate fruity bouquet, with hints of apple and banana. Pleasantly lively at the palate with the right balance between sweetness and acidity.

Food pairing

Goes well as an aperitif, throughout meals with light foods.
